Fórum Autoincrementar no Firebird ? #45570
19/07/2004
0
Caro programadores,
Estou começando agora a usar o Firebird , não estou conseguindo fazer o autoincremente, já coloquei o Triggers e também o generators mas acho que não estou acionando , pois não gera os códigos, uso o DBexpress
componentes : Sqlconection, Sqldataset , datasetprovider e clientedataset.
se alguem puder me ajudar agradeço !
Hugo Fabrício
Estou começando agora a usar o Firebird , não estou conseguindo fazer o autoincremente, já coloquei o Triggers e também o generators mas acho que não estou acionando , pois não gera os códigos, uso o DBexpress
componentes : Sqlconection, Sqldataset , datasetprovider e clientedataset.
se alguem puder me ajudar agradeço !
Hugo Fabrício
Hugofab
Curtir tópico
+ 0
Responder
Posts
19/07/2004
Bferreira
Caro programadores,
Estou começando agora a usar o Firebird , não estou conseguindo fazer o autoincremente, já coloquei o Triggers e também o generators mas acho que não estou acionando , pois não gera os códigos, uso o DBexpress
componentes : Sqlconection, Sqldataset , datasetprovider e clientedataset.
se alguem puder me ajudar agradeço !
Hugo Fabrício
Consegui usar normalmente as triggers e os generators para o alto increment no firebird, da mesma forma q faço no interbase.
poste os scripts da sua trigger e do generator para eu dar uma olhada
t+
Responder
Gostei + 0
19/07/2004
Hugofab
esta ai o script triggers e generators.
veja se tem algo errado !
IF(NEW.CODCLIENTE IS NULL) THEN NEW.CODCLIENTE = GEN_ID(GEN_CLIENTE_CODCLIENTE,1);
CREATE GENERATOR GEN_CLIENTE_CODCLIENTE;
Hugo Fabrício
veja se tem algo errado !
IF(NEW.CODCLIENTE IS NULL) THEN NEW.CODCLIENTE = GEN_ID(GEN_CLIENTE_CODCLIENTE,1);
CREATE GENERATOR GEN_CLIENTE_CODCLIENTE;
Hugo Fabrício
Responder
Gostei + 0
Clique aqui para fazer login e interagir na Comunidade :)